Paediatric ophthalmology is a branch of ophthalmology that focuses on eye care for children. Children's eyes are still developing, hence the conditions that affect them are often different from that in adults.

A Paediatric Ophthalmologist specialises in diagnosing and treating eye conditions that can affect a child’s vision and development with particular expertise in eye alignment disorders (strabismus) and visual development problems.

What are the causes of poor vision in a child?

1. Refractive Errors

Can be in different forms – near sightedness (myopia), far sightedness (hyperopia), astigmatism (cylinder). Occurs when light is not properly focused on the retina, resulting in blurred vision.
Symptoms: blurred vision (near or distance), squinting, eye strain, abnormal head posture.

2. Strabismus (Squint)

Misalignment of the eyes (inward, outward, upward, or downward).
Symptoms: double vision (in older children), abnormal head posture.

3. Amblyopia (Lazy Eye)

Reduced vision due to disrupted visual development, often caused by uncorrected refractive errors, strabismus, or visual deprivation (e.g. cataract, droopy eyelid).

4. Eyelid and Ocular Surface Conditions

  • Allergic eye disease: redness, itching, tearing, discharge
  • Infective conjunctivitis: red eye, sticky discharge, crusting
  • Stye or chalazion: painful eyelid lump
  • Ptosis: drooping eyelid obstructing vision
  • Blocked naso-lacrimal duct: persistent tearing or sticky lashes in infants

5. Other Causes

  • Eye injuries (sometimes children may not tell their parents when they sustain an injury)
  • Cataract
  • Glaucoma
  • Corneal, retinal, or optic nerve diseases
  • Inherited disorders
  • Tumours (e.g. retinoblastoma)

There can be many causes for poor vision in a child. Some of these are very simple and treated easily, while others may be very difficult to manage and sometimes may even be life threatening.

Therefore, it is prudent to contact an ophthalmologist at the earliest if you suspect poor vision in your child. He or she will confirm poor vision and then look for the cause of the same. A timely treatment is very crucial in saving the sight and sometimes the life of the child.
